Agitators stages sit-in-protest in District Hospital, service disrupted

The health service of the district has been severely affected n May 2 due to the padlocking of the District Hospital by the agitators in protest of death of post-natal woman accusing the negligence of doctor. All services have been disrupted except the emergency services.

Patients are facing difficulties after OPD, X-ray and pathological services were disrupted due to the agitation.

One of the patient, Kamal Khadka said that he came to the hospital to get immunization for tuberculosis however he was deprived of the service due to the agitation. He added that he was compelled to pay higher price to get the same immunization at local medical. After the disruption of the service, patients are heading to Dang via ambulance according to local Mahendra Ahrestha.

On May 1, postnatal woman Radhika Dhami of Pyuthan Municipality-2 had died during operation.

The agitators have also disrupted the transportation affecting short and long routed vehicles.

According to acting chief Dr Sushil Acharya of the hospital, the dialogue between the victims party and CDO is continuing to solve the issue.
